FArea.asp
上传用户:mtjhgs
上传日期:2021-12-08
资源大小:3755k
文件大小:4k
源码类别:

WEB源码(ASP,PHP,...)

开发平台:

HTML/CSS

  1. <!-- #include file="ConnStatData.asp" -->
  2. <!-- #Include File="CheckAdmin.asp"-->
  3. <%
  4. Response.Expires=0
  5. Dim Percent(),BarWidth()
  6. Dim TotalNum,Assay,MaxWidth,Rows,i,ExFor
  7. ExFor=0
  8. MaxWidth=270
  9. TotalNum=0
  10. Sql="Select * From FArea Order By TAreNum DESC"
  11. Rs.Open Sql,Conn,1,1
  12. If Not Rs.Bof And Not Rs.Eof Then
  13.    Assay=Rs.GetRows
  14.    Rows=Ubound(Assay,2)
  15. Else
  16.    Rows=-1
  17. End If
  18. Rs.Close
  19. Conn.Close
  20. Set Rs=Nothing
  21. Set Conn=Nothing
  22. For i=0 to Rows
  23. TotalNum=TotalNum+Assay(1,i)
  24. Next
  25. ReDim Percent(Rows)
  26. ReDim BarWidth(Rows)
  27. For i=0 to Rows
  28.     If TotalNum>0 Then
  29.    Percent(i)=FormatNumber(Int(Assay(1,i)/TotalNum*10000)/100,2,-1)&"%"
  30.        BarWidth(i)=Assay(1,i)/TotalNum*MaxWidth
  31. End If
  32. Next
  33. %>
  34. <HTML>
  35. <HEAD>
  36. <TITLE>网站统计分析系统</TITLE>
  37. <META content="text/html; charset=gb2312" http-equiv=Content-Type>
  38. <link rel="stylesheet" href="../admin/images/admin.css">
  39. </HEAD>
  40. <%
  41. if Instr(session("AdminPurview"),"|40,")=0 then 
  42.     response.write ("<br><br><div align=""center""><font style=""color:red; font-size:9pt; "")>您没有管理该模块的权限!</font></div>")
  43.   response.end
  44. end if
  45. '========判断是否具有管理权限
  46. %>
  47. <BODY>
  48.   <div align="center">
  49.     <table width="95%" border="0" align="center" cellpadding="3" cellspacing="1"  class="tableborder">
  50.       <tr>
  51.         <th colspan="8">网站流量统计:包括年,月,日,IP,浏览器类型等非常详细的分析报表</th>
  52.       </tr>
  53.       <tr>
  54.         <td align="center" class="forumrow"><a href="Infolist.asp">统计概况</a></td>
  55.         <td align="center" class="forumrow"><a href="FVisitor.asp">最近访问</a></td>
  56.         <td align="center" class="forumrow"><a href="StatYear.asp">年 报 表</a></td>
  57.         <td align="center" class="forumrow"><a href="StatMonth.asp">月 报 表</a></td>
  58.         <td align="center" class="forumrow"><a href="StatWeek.asp">周 报 表</a></td>
  59.         <td align="center" class="forumrow"><a href="StatDay.asp">日 报 表</a></td>
  60.         <td align="center" class="forumrow"><a href="History.asp">历史报表</a></td>
  61.         <td align="center" class="forumrow"><a href="Rereg.asp">修改信息</a></td>
  62.       </tr>
  63.       <tr>
  64.         <td align="center" class="forumrow"><a href="FArea.asp">地区分析</a></td>
  65.         <td align="center" class="forumrow"><a href="FAddress.asp">地址分析</a></td>
  66.         <td align="center" class="forumrow"><a href="FIptwo.asp">IP 地 址</a></td>
  67.         <td align="center" class="forumrow"><a href="Fweburl.asp">链接页面</a></td>
  68.         <td align="center" class="forumrow"><a href="FCounter.asp">访问次数</a></td>
  69.         <td align="center" class="forumrow"><a href="FSystem.asp">操作系统</a></td>
  70.         <td align="center" class="forumrow"><a href="FBrowser.asp">浏 览 器</a></td>
  71.         <td align="center" class="forumrow"><a href="FScreen.asp">屏幕大小</a></td>
  72.       </tr>
  73.   </table>
  74.     <br>
  75.     <table width="95%" border="0" align="center" cellpadding="3" cellspacing="1"  class="tableborder">
  76.       <tr>
  77.         <th colspan="4">访问者所在地区分析&nbsp;</strong>(&nbsp;总量:<%=TotalNum%>&nbsp;)</font></td>
  78.       </tr>
  79.       <tr>
  80.         <td width="25%" class="title">所在地区</td>
  81.         <td width="20%" class="title">访问人数</td>
  82.         <td width="15%" class="title">百分比</td>
  83.         <td width="40%" class="title">图示</td>
  84.       </tr>
  85.       <%for i=0 to Rows
  86.     Exfor=Exfor+1%>
  87.       <tr onMouseOver = 'this.style.backgroundColor = "#FFFFFF"' onMouseOut = 'this.style.backgroundColor = ""' style="cursor:hand">
  88.         <td class="forumrow"><%=Assay(0,i)%></td>
  89.         <td class="forumrowhighlight"><%=Assay(1,i)%></td>
  90.         <td class="forumrow"><%=Percent(i)%></td>
  91.         <td class="forumrowhighlight"><img src="Images/bar.gif" width="<%=Barwidth(i)%> "height="8"></td>
  92.       </tr>
  93.       <%If Exfor>=30 Then Exit For
  94.     Next%>
  95.     </table>
  96.   </div>
  97. </BODY>
  98. </HTML>